ISMAR8

15-19 October 2013, Beijing, China

“Managing Aquifer Recharge: Meeting the Water Resource Challenge”

ISMAR8 was held in Beijing, China on the 15-19 October 2013. The symposium was promoted by IAH-MAR Working Group and the universities of Tsinghua and Jinan. The event was supported by institutions and companies such as UNESCO, China Geological Survey, National Natural and Scientific Foundation of China, Beijing Drainage Corp., Research Center for Eco-Environmental Science, Gaobeidian Sewage Treatment Plant, Beijing Hydraulic Research Institute, Jilin University, Beta Analytic, etc. 149 delegates from 27 countries attended the symposium, which included 6 workshops, 83 oral presentations and 38 poster were exhibited. A total of 121 papers were written, covering five thematic groups.

Thematic issues of journals

Selected papers resulting from the conference were published as thematic issues in three journals:

Environmental Earth Sciences, vol. 73, no. 12, June 2015
Thematic Issue “ISMAR8 China”

Guest editors: Xuan Zhao, Weiping Wang

Journal of Hydrologic Engineering, vol. 20, no. 3, March 2015
Special Issue: “8th International Symposium on Managed Aquifer Recharge”

Guest editors: Zhuping Sheng and Xuan Zhao

Water, vol. 7, no. 2, 2014/2015
Special Issue: “Policy and Economics of Managed Aquifer Recharge and Water Banking”

Guest editors: Sharon B. Megdal and Peter Dillon

The open-access issue contains 14 papers most of which were developed from those presented at ISMAR8. This issue has also been published as a hardbound book and the issue and book are available from the thematic issue web site.
